Eye watering £3million needed to save Southport Pier

23rd August 2022

Southport Pier will need three million pounds of repairs carrying out urgently.

Sefton Council published a report today effectively condemning the current state of the pier’s decking, which has already caused numerous injuries and accidents.

Council chiefs say they have got no choice but to try and borrow £3 million to replace the full length of the iconic Southport pier’s walkway.

The existing floorboards, which have only been in place since a previous refurbishment in the year 2000, have rotted away after 22 years of exposure.

While the council say the pier is still safe enough to remain open, they have pulled the small pier train from service to minimise the damage to the decking.

Work is expected to start in October after the summer season has ended.
